Essential Steps for Strengthening Corporate Website Security
In today’s digital landscape, the security of your corporate website is paramount. With increasing cyber threats, businesses must prioritize website security hardening to protect sensitive data and maintain customer trust. This blog outlines essential steps to enhance your corporate website security, ensuring your business remains resilient against potential attacks.

Understanding the Importance of Website Security
Website security is not just about protecting your site from hackers; it’s about safeguarding your brand reputation and ensuring compliance with regulations. A compromised website can lead to data breaches, loss of customer trust, and significant financial losses. Here are some key reasons why website security should be a top priority:
- Data Protection: Safeguarding customer information and sensitive business data.
- Brand Reputation: Maintaining trust and credibility with your audience.
- Compliance: Adhering to legal requirements and industry standards.
- Business Continuity: Ensuring uninterrupted operations and service availability.
Step 1: Conduct a Security Audit
The first step in hardening your corporate website security is to conduct a thorough security audit. This involves assessing your current security measures and identifying vulnerabilities. Here’s how to perform an effective security audit:
- Identify Assets: List all digital assets, including websites, databases, and applications.
- Assess Vulnerabilities: Use tools to scan for vulnerabilities in your website’s code and infrastructure.
- Review Security Policies: Evaluate existing security policies and procedures for effectiveness.
- Penetration Testing: Conduct simulated attacks to test your defenses.
Step 2: Implement Strong Authentication Measures
Strong authentication is crucial for preventing unauthorized access to your website. Implement the following measures to enhance authentication:
- Multi-Factor Authentication (MFA): Require users to provide multiple forms of verification.
- Strong Password Policies: Enforce complex password requirements and regular password changes.
- Account Lockout Mechanisms: Temporarily lock accounts after multiple failed login attempts.
Step 3: Keep Software Up to Date
Outdated software is a common entry point for cybercriminals. Regularly updating your website’s software, including content management systems (CMS), plugins, and security patches, can significantly reduce vulnerabilities. Here’s how to manage software updates:
- Automate Updates: Use automated systems to ensure timely updates.
- Monitor for Vulnerabilities: Stay informed about known vulnerabilities and patches.
- Test Updates: Test updates in a staging environment before deploying them live.
Step 4: Utilize Cloud Technologies for Enhanced Security
Cloud technologies offer robust security features that can enhance your website’s protection. Consider the following cloud-based solutions:
- Content Delivery Networks (CDNs): Use CDNs to distribute traffic and mitigate DDoS attacks.
- Web Application Firewalls (WAFs): Implement WAFs to filter and monitor HTTP traffic to your website.
- Data Backup Solutions: Utilize cloud storage for regular backups to ensure data recovery in case of an incident.
Step 5: Automate Security Processes
Business process automation can streamline security measures and enhance efficiency. Automation tools can help in various areas, including:
- Monitoring and Alerts: Set up automated alerts for suspicious activities or breaches.
- Regular Security Scans: Automate vulnerability scanning to identify potential threats proactively.
- Integration with CRM Systems: Use platforms like Bitrix24 or HubSpot to manage leads and automate security checks in your sales pipeline.
Conclusion: Embrace Digital Transformation for Security
As businesses undergo digital transformation, the importance of website security cannot be overstated. By implementing these essential steps, you can significantly enhance your corporate website security and protect your business from potential threats. The integration of cloud technologies and business process automation not only strengthens security but also streamlines operations, allowing your team to focus on growth and innovation.
In a world where cyber threats are constantly evolving, staying ahead of the curve is crucial. Regularly review and update your security measures, invest in the latest technologies, and consider IT outsourcing in Ukraine to leverage expertise in corporate website development, landing pages, and e-commerce stores.
At Ubtech, we specialize in providing comprehensive IT services, including web and mobile development, CRM solutions, SEO, corporate websites, landing pages, and e-commerce solutions. Partner with us to enhance your digital presence while ensuring robust security for your business.
Best Practices for Ongoing Website Security
Maintaining a secure website is an ongoing process that requires vigilance and adherence to best practices. Here are some essential practices to implement:
- Regular Security Training: Educate employees about security risks and best practices to minimize human error.
- Incident Response Plan: Develop a clear plan for responding to security breaches, including roles and responsibilities.
- Regular Backups: Schedule automated backups to ensure data can be restored quickly in case of a breach.
- Security Monitoring: Utilize security information and event management (SIEM) tools to monitor and analyze security events in real-time.
Key Performance Indicators (KPIs) for Measuring Security Effectiveness
To assess the effectiveness of your website security measures, it’s crucial to track specific KPIs. Here are some important metrics to consider:
Implementation of Security Measures
Implementing security measures effectively requires a structured approach. Here’s a step-by-step guide to ensure that your security protocols are not only established but also maintained:
- Define Security Policies: Clearly outline the security policies that govern user access, data handling, and incident response.
- Assign Roles and Responsibilities: Designate team members responsible for various aspects of website security, ensuring accountability.
- Schedule Regular Reviews: Set a timeline for periodic reviews of security measures to adapt to new threats and technologies.
- Engage Stakeholders: Involve key stakeholders in discussions about security to foster a culture of security awareness across the organization.
Pitfalls to Avoid in Website Security
While enhancing website security, it’s essential to be aware of common pitfalls that can undermine your efforts. Here are some key pitfalls to avoid:
- Neglecting User Education: Failing to educate users about security risks can lead to vulnerabilities due to human error.
- Overlooking Third-Party Risks: Not assessing the security of third-party vendors can expose your website to additional risks.
- Ignoring Compliance Requirements: Non-compliance with regulations can result in legal issues and financial penalties.
- Underestimating the Importance of Testing: Skipping regular testing of security measures can leave vulnerabilities unaddressed.
“`
- Incident Response Time: Measure the time taken to detect and respond to security incidents.
- Number of Vulnerabilities Detected: Track the number of vulnerabilities identified during audits and scans.
- Percentage of Employees Trained: Monitor the percentage of staff who have completed security training programs.
- Backup Success Rate: Evaluate the success rate of automated backups to ensure data integrity.
“`
FAQ
- What is website security hardening?
- Website security hardening involves implementing measures to protect a website from cyber threats and vulnerabilities.
- Why is a security audit important?
- A security audit identifies vulnerabilities and assesses the effectiveness of existing security measures.
- How can cloud technologies enhance website security?
- Cloud technologies provide robust security features such as CDNs and WAFs that help protect websites from attacks.
- What role does automation play in website security?
- Automation streamlines security processes, allowing for regular monitoring, alerts, and vulnerability scanning.
- How can I ensure my website software is up to date?
- Regularly monitor for updates and utilize automated systems to manage software updates effectively.